- The distance between Chanthaburi, Thailand and Anchorage, Alaska, Usa is approximately 9,712 km or 6,035 mi.
- To reach Chanthaburi in this distance one would set out from Anchorage, Alaska bearing 291.6°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Chanthaburi bearing 207.4° or SSW .
- Chanthaburi has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am) whereas Anchorage, Alaska has a boreal subarctic climate with dry summers (Dsc).
- Chanthaburi is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Anchorage, Alaska is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 24.6 °C (44.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 21.4 °C (38.5°F) less in Chanthaburi.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2468.9 mm (97.2 in) more which is equivalent to 2468.9 l/m² (60.59 US gal/ft²) or 24,689,000 l/ha (2,639,418 US gal/ac) more. About 7 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 43.8° higher in Chanthaburi than in Anchorage, Alaska.
